Understanding Our Game System

At our heart, we operates on simple mechanics. Players drop a chip from the peak of the pyramid-shaped board, studded with rows of pegs arranged in a pyramid formation. As gravity pulls the chip downward, it collides with these pegs, bouncing left or right at each contact moment. The final landing place determines the payout multiplier, with slots at the bottom providing different amounts.

Our Probability Engine That Powers Us

The mathematical foundation supporting the gameplay is the binomial distribution. At each peg, the disc has roughly a 50/50 chance of moving left or right. With multiple rows, the cumulative effect produces a probability distribution where middle positions are statistically more likely than outer sides. This is why Plinko features higher multipliers at the edge slots—they are harder to hit, and the prize structure reflects this mathematical reality.

Count of Lines
Total Possible Paths
Middle Slot Chance
Edge Position Chance
8 Rows 256 27.34% 0.39%
12 Rows 4,096 19.31% 0.024%
16 Rows 65,536 15.96% 0.0015%

Strategic Approaches Users Use

While it’s fundamentally a game of chance, experienced players employ different strategic approaches while engaging with us. Risk tolerance determines most tactical decisions, as our different configurations provide distinct volatility profiles.

  1. Low-risk grinding: Players select 8-row setups and aim for frequent, modest wins by targeting middle multipliers with lower volatility
  2. High-risk hunting: Aggressive players select 16-row setups with dramatic payout differences, accepting frequent losses for occasional jackpot opportunities
  3. Bankroll management systems: Some apply progressive betting patterns, though the independent trial nature means past results don’t influence future outcomes
  4. Session-based approaches: Setting win/loss limits before engagement helps players maintain control during prolonged play periods
